Abstract

D-Glycals react smoothly with a variety of alcohols in a highly stereoselective manner in the presence of the CeCl3·7H2O-NaI reagent system in refluxing acetonitrile under neutral conditions to afford the corresponding 2-deoxy-α-glycopyranosides in high yields. In the absence of NaI, the glycals undergo Ferrier rearrangement under the influence of CeCl3·7H2O in refluxing acetonitrile to afford the corresponding 2,3-unsaturated hexopyranosides in good yields.
